Executive - Underwriting & Placement
Job Summary
We are seeking an experienced and Executive – Underwriting & Placement to oversee the evaluation of corporate risks and the placement of insurance coverage with leading insurers. In this role, you will drive the underwriting process for various corporate insurance products (e.g., Property & Casualty, Liability, Group Health, and specialized lines), negotiate with insurers, and ensure optimal coverage terms. The ideal candidate brings strong technical knowledge, proven market relationships, and a track record in underwriting or broking for corporate clients.
